Sec. 46.10-15  Survey for the establishment and renewal of subdivision 
load line marks.

    (a) Every passenger vessel to be marked with and certificated for 
subdivision load lines must comply with the requirements as set forth in 
subchapter H (Passenger Vessels) of this chapter for ocean, coastwise, 
and Great

[[Page 95]]

Lakes service as applicable to the particular vessel and the service in 
which she is to be employed.
    (b) Every passenger vessel marked with a subdivision load line shall 
be subjected to the surveys specified in this paragraph. The details of 
the surveys or inspections indicated in paragraphs (b)(1) through (3) of 
this section shall be as set forth in the applicable sections of part 71 
of subchapter H (Passenger Vessels) of this chapter.
    (1) A survey before the vessel is put in service.
    (2) A periodical survey once every 12 months.
    (3) Additional surveys as occasion arises.
    (4) Surveys required by part 42, part 44, or part 45 of this 
subchapter.
